Binary tree adt python

WebA binary tree is a tree data structure in which each parent node can have at most two children. Each node of a binary tree consists of three items: data item. address of left child. address of right child. Binary Tree. WebNov 16, 2024 · A tree is a complex data structure used to store data (nodes) in a “parent/child” relationship.The top node of a tree (the node with no parent) is called the root.Each node of a tree can have 0, 1 or several child nodes.In a Binary Tree, each node can have a maximum of two child nodes.. The Breadth-First Traversal of a tree is used …

Implement Binary Tree in Python - OpenGenus IQ: Computing …

WebFeb 10, 2024 · A Binary tree is a data structure in which there is a parent object and each object can have zero, one or two children. Generally we call the object a Node and each … WebTree combines the advantages of arrays and linked lists. The nature of BST (i.e being ordered) makes it potential for extensive applications. For example, implementing set (ADT). Design and Implementation: Using … how long are bts run episodes https://mjcarr.net

How Binary Search Tree works in Python? - EduCBA

WebBinary tree is special type of heirarichal data structures defined using nodes. Basically its extended version of linked list. Its a tree data structure where each node is allowed to … WebBinary trees is a special case of trees where each node can have at most 2 children. Also, these children are named: left child or right child . A very useful specialization of binary … WebDEFINITION A binary tree is either empty, or it consists of a node called the root together with two binary trees called the left subtree and the right subtree of the root. There is one empty binary tree, one binary tree with one node, and two with two nodes: and These are different from each other. We never draw any part of a binary tree to ... how long are brats good for in freezer

python - How to implement a binary tree? - Stack Overflow

Category:Chapter 10 BINARY TREES - George Mason University

Tags:Binary tree adt python

Binary tree adt python

Tree Data Structure Algorithm Tutor

WebBinary Search Trees Binary Search Trees Definition: Binary Search Trees Definition: Let T be a binary tree. Binary Search. ... Data Structures for Map ADT Find Insert Delete UnsortedArrayMap ࠵?(࠵?) ࠵?(࠵?) ࠵? ... Python programming language; Division mathematics; Harvard University • CSCI S- 1B. lec 4.pdf. 69. WebQuestion: Implement the following problem statement in Python 3.7 using BINARY TREE ADT (Data Structure Problem in Python). Problem Statement At the school library, there is a need for a new library management system. One of the basic requirements of the system is to keep track of which books are in the library and which ones have been issued / …

Binary tree adt python

Did you know?

WebBinary Search Trees (BST) Binary trees is a special case of trees where each node can have at most 2 children. Also, these children are named: left child or right child.A very useful specialization of binary trees is binary search tree (BST) where nodes are conventionally ordered in a certain manner. By convention, the \(\text{left children} < \text{parent} < … WebOct 12, 2024 · Implementing a Binary Tree Binary Trees always start with a root node. In order to add objects to the tree, you have to design an algorithm to traverse your tree, find a node that has...

WebBinary Tree ADT According To 9618 A Level Computer Science (Python) pineapple999 dot net 2.05K subscribers 10 798 views 7 months ago Explanation / live coding of the … WebMar 22, 2024 · A ‘Binary Search Tree‘ is an ADT such that T ... Figure 4.2: Operations Applied to a Tree . The Code # Binary Search Tree Python implementation class BinarySearchTree: # -----Nested Node Class ----- # …

WebTree combines the advantages of arrays and linked lists. The nature of BST (i.e being ordered) makes it potential for extensive applications. For example, implementing set … WebImplement ways to retrieve the price values, delete and set values. (10 Marks) 3.2 Uaing the python ADT class binarytree, write a python program that creates a binary tree such that each intemal node of the binary tree stores a single character, and the pre-order traversal of the trees gives EXAMFUN while the in-order traversal reads MAFXUEN.

WebJul 25, 2024 · First you can implement your BinaryTree.printTree () function as _Node.printTree (). You can't do a straight copy and paste, but the logic of the function won't have to change much. Or you could leave the method where it is at, but wrap each _left or _right node inside of a new BinaryTree so that they would have the necessary printTree …

WebJan 8, 2024 · A binary tree is defined as a tree in which no node can have more than two children. The highest degree of any node is two. This indicates that the degree of a binary tree is either zero or one or two. In the above fig., the binary tree consists of a root and two sub trees TreeLeft & TreeRight. how long are breaks between sat sectionsWebMar 21, 2024 · A Binary tree is represented by a pointer to the topmost node (commonly known as the “root”) of the tree. If the tree is empty, then the value of the root is NULL. Each node of a Binary Tree contains the … how long are brps valid forWebUsing the python ADT class binarytree, write a python program (not Java) that creates a binary tree such that each internal node of the binary tree stores a single character, and the pre-order traversal of the trees gives EXAMFUN while the in-order traversal reads MAFXUEN. Your tasks include: Write the class binarytree with three functions, the … how long are bullard hard hats good forWebQuestion: Binary tree (python) This assignment will help you understand and implement a Binary Search Tree. It will allow you to write an add, remove and rebalance method within the binary tree ADT. You have probably heard of the famous story “Around the World in 80 Days” by Jules Verne, even if you’ve never actually read it. how long are breathing treatmentsWebSyntax: The syntax flow for the binary search Tree in Python is as follows: class A_node: def _init_( self, key), #Put and initialize the key and value pait #Then a utility function as per requirement can be written def insert( root, key) #define function #Write the driver program & print with a logger to understand the flow. how long are burial plots keptWebA tree is recursively defined non-linear (hierarchical) data structure. It comprises nodes linked together in a hierarchical manner. Each node has a label and the references to the child nodes. Figure 1 shows an example … how long are breaks in basketballWebSep 1, 2024 · We can implement a binary tree node in python as follows. class BinaryTreeNode: def __init__(self, data): self.data = data self.leftChild = None self.rightChild=None What is a Binary Search Tree? A binary … how long are british election campaigns